    Where did you get the software update from?



    A TvStar Box is not a Saorview approved box its a cheap clone that gives only the picture without any teletext...have seen countless problems with them. Picture dropout could be due to a badly aligned aerial. Do you have any other box or Saorview tv in the house you can test the signal with.
